Court: Cellphone, tumor tied

Italy’s top court has ruled that a businessman developed a benign brain tumor because he held a cellphone to his ear for hours daily for his job and deserves worker’s compensation. Texas Approves 85-MPH Speed Limit, Fastest In United States

The highest speed limit in the United States can now be found on a central Texas highway.  Transportation officials in the state approved an 85-mile-per-hour speed limit along a 41-mile stretch of State Highway 130, which runs between suburbs of Austin and San Antonio.
